For an immediate immersion into the region’s natural splendor, prioritize a hike along the South West Coast Path, specifically the section from Salcombe to Bolt Head. This route offers dramatic cliff-top views, secluded sandy coves accessible only on foot, and a chance to witness peregrine falcons nesting. Pack sturdy footwear and a water bottle, as the terrain is challenging but rewards with unparalleled coastal scenery. This area, a designated Area of Outstanding Natural Beauty, showcases the raw, untamed coastline that defines the county’s character.
To experience the quintessential pastoral charm, rent a bicycle in Totnes and follow the Dart Valley Cycle Way. This relatively flat 10-kilometer path winds through ancient woodlands and alongside the serene River Dart, leading to the Sharpham Estate. Here, you can sample award-winning local cheeses and wines produced using sustainable farming methods. The journey itself is a study in bucolic tranquility, with rolling hills and historic stone bridges punctuating the verdant countryside.
For a deeper connection with the area’s wild core, a guided excursion into Dartmoor National Park is indispensable. Focus on the High Moor around Princetown to explore Bronze Age stone circles, such as Merrivale, and the imposing granite tors that dominate the skyline. An experienced guide can point out specific archaeological sites and explain the unique geology and folklore of this expansive, heather-clad moorland, ensuring a safe and informative exploration of its rugged interior.

How to Incorporate a Verdant Hue into a Small Urban Garden Design
Utilize vertical space by installing a living wall system planted with shade-tolerant ferns like Asplenium scolopendrium and mosses. This technique maximizes planting area in compact courtyards or balconies. Select containers in contrasting colors, such as terracotta or dark grey, to make the foliage pop. A pot with a diameter of 30-40 cm is sufficient for a single specimen of Hosta ‘Sum and Substance’, whose large, chartreuse leaves create a bold statement.
Choose plants with varying textures to add depth. Combine the fine, feathery fronds of Adiantum venustum (Himalayan maidenhair fern) with the broad, glossy leaves of Fatsia japonica. This pairing creates visual interest without overcrowding. For ground cover in tight spaces, use Soleirolia soleirolii (mind-your-own-business), which forms a dense, low-growing mat of tiny, bright leaves, perfect for planting between paving stones or at the base of larger pots.
Integrate plants that offer seasonal color shifts. The young leaves of Acer palmatum ‘Katsura’ emerge with an orange tint before maturing to a bright, yellowish-leaf shade, providing a dynamic display throughout the year. For year-round structure, a clipped boxwood (Buxus sempervirens) sphere in a sleek, modern planter provides a formal element and a constant source of deep, rich coloration.
Employ reflective surfaces to amplify light and the perception of space. A strategically placed mirror behind a planting of Hakonechloa macra ‘Aureola’ will double the visual impact of its cascading, striped blades. For lighting, use upward-facing spotlights to illuminate the undersides of leaves, highlighting their structure and casting dramatic shadows on adjacent walls after dusk.
Step-by-Step Guide to Propagating This Emerald Cultivar from Cuttings
Select a healthy, non-flowering stem from the parent plant that is at least 15 centimeters long. Use a sterilized bypass pruner to make a clean, 45-degree angle cut just below a leaf node. This specific angle maximizes the surface area for water absorption and root development. Remove all leaves from the lower two-thirds of the cutting, leaving only 3-4 leaves at the top to reduce moisture loss through transpiration.
Prepare a rooting medium by mixing one part perlite with one part sphagnum peat moss. This combination provides optimal aeration and moisture retention. Fill a 10-centimeter pot with this mixture, leaving a 2-centimeter space at the top. Moisten the medium thoroughly with filtered water until it is damp but not waterlogged. Use a pencil or a dibber to create a hole in the center of the medium, approximately 5-7 centimeters deep.
Dip the cut end of the stem into a rooting hormone powder or gel, ensuring the bottom 2-3 centimeters are coated. Tap off any excess powder. Gently insert the treated end of the cutting into the pre-made hole in the potting mix. Firm the medium around the base of the stem to ensure good contact and eliminate air pockets. This contact is necessary for nutrient and water uptake.
Create a humid environment by covering the pot with a clear plastic bag or a propagator lid. Secure the bag with a rubber band around the pot’s rim, but ensure it does not touch the leaves. Place the potted cutting in a location with bright, indirect sunlight. A north-facing window is suitable. Maintain a consistent temperature between 21-24°C (70-75°F). Mist the inside of the bag every 2-3 days to maintain high humidity.
Check for root formation after 4-6 weeks by gently tugging on the stem. If you feel resistance, roots have formed. Once the root system is established, which can be confirmed by roots appearing through the drainage holes, you can acclimate the new plant. Gradually remove the plastic cover over a period of one week, increasing the exposure time each day. After full acclimation, transplant the young plant into a larger container with standard potting soil.
Managing Common Pests and Diseases Affecting This Aglaonema in a Home Setting
To combat spider mites, which appear as fine webbing on leaf undersides, immediately isolate the plant. Wipe all foliage with a soft cloth soaked in a solution of 1 part 70% isopropyl alcohol to 3 parts water. Repeat this treatment every 4-7 days for at least three weeks to disrupt the mite life cycle. For heavy infestations, apply a horticultural oil spray, ensuring complete coverage of all plant surfaces, especially the joints where stems meet leaves.
For mealybugs, identifiable by their white, cotton-like masses in leaf axils and along stems, spot-treat with a cotton swab dipped directly in 70% isopropyl alcohol. This dissolves their waxy protective coating. Follow up by spraying the entire plant with an insecticidal soap, paying close attention to crevices. Re-inspect weekly and re-treat as new pests emerge. Introducing lacewing larvae can provide biological control for persistent issues.
Root rot, a fungal issue caused by excessive moisture, manifests as yellowing lower leaves and a mushy stem base. Immediately unpot the specimen and inspect the roots. Trim away any black, soft, or foul-smelling roots with sterilized scissors. Repot into a fresh, well-draining potting mix containing perlite or orchid bark. Adjust your watering schedule to allow the top 5-7 cm of soil to dry out completely between waterings. Ensure the pot has adequate drainage holes.
Bacterial leaf spot presents as dark, water-soaked lesions, often with a yellow halo. Remove affected leaves at the base with a sterile blade to prevent spread. Avoid misting the foliage, as water on leaves facilitates bacterial proliferation. Improve air circulation around the plant by spacing it from others. A copper-based bactericide can be applied as a foliar spray according to product instructions if the infection is severe, but physical removal of affected parts is the primary control method.
